Queen's Brian May lends his support to The Soldiers' Charity
12 July 2010
A group of celebrities, school children, companies and serving soldiers have come together to record No One But You (Only The Good Die Young) by Brian May.
The single features celebrities including Alice Barry from Shameless, Ian Aspinall from Holby City, Darren Day and Rachel Hylton of X Factor fame. Along with serving soldiers and children from Worsthorne Primary School the studio was packed with supporters ready and willing to do their bit for The Soldiers’ Charity.
Regional Director of Fundraising for the North West, Lt Col Philip Aindow, even took a turn on the microphone!
Raynor Pepper of Making Some Memories Ltd, one of the three companies behind the single, commented “we thought it would be fitting to have a song representing the dedication and hard work these service men and women actually do.”
“For the world we live in, it is charities like this that are around to help assist these servicemen and women when in need.”
The other companies involved are Bar Rojo/CDL Leisure and Rock Hard Music Group Ltd.
